Given Input Data is 524, 155, 946, 611
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 524 is 2 x 2 x 131
Prime Factorization of 155 is 5 x 31
Prime Factorization of 946 is 2 x 11 x 43
Prime Factorization of 611 is 13 x 47
The above numbers do not have any common prime factor. So GCD is 1
